Bicycle Repair in Willard, KY
2. Pedal Power Inc
2981 Cyrus Creek Rd, Barboursville, WV 25504
4. Huntington Cycle and Sport
1010 10th St, Huntington, WV 25701
CLOSED NOW:Closed
Amenities:
Showing 1-4 of 4
2981 Cyrus Creek Rd, Barboursville, WV 25504
1010 10th St, Huntington, WV 25701
Showing 1-4 of 4